The periodic table is a tool used to group elements based on their chemical properties. The elements in the periodic table are arranged in rows called periods and columns known as groups, based on increasing atomic number.

- The elements on the periodic table are arranged in order of increasing atomic number.
- The arrangement of the elements on the periodic table shows a predictable, repeating, periodic pattern that allows us to predict chemical properties.
- The elements Na, Mg, and Cu are each classified as metal elements.
- When elements are located in the same group they exhibit similar chemical and physical properties.
- The element chlorine is an example of an element that is classified as a nonmetal.
